Surprise box

As a birthday present for her boyfriend, she gave him a handmade surprise box.

It’s full of various pop-up gimmicks like a pop-up book.

When you turn the pages, lots of photos and messages appear.

Using screenshots from LINE also feels very contemporary and nice.

So moving! We rented out Grandpa’s favorite restaurant for a birthday party

When renting a venue like a restaurant for a birthday party, choosing the guest of honor’s regular spot will make them happy.

Gather everyone as you would for your usual meal, and ask the restaurant in advance to prepare a surprise cake or dessert.

This is a great option for people with large families or older guests who value memories over material gifts.

Let’s make a giant pudding in a rice cooker instead of a birthday cake.

A giant pudding is recommended when lots of people are gathering for a birthday party or for children’s birthday parties.

You can make this coveted giant pudding with your usual rice cooker—no special tools or molds required.

The key is to warm it slowly on the keep-warm setting for four hours.

It’s also a good idea to work backward from the chilling time and prepare it the day before the party.

snack refrigerator

How about packing a bunch of your favorite sweets into a small box and giving it to a friend as a gift? Prepare four boxes, attach them together, and use the box lids inside to create dividers.

Once you’re set, fill them with as many cute treats as you like.

It may look simple on the outside, but it’s overflowing with goodies when you open it—sure to be a hit.

A birthday surprise video featuring the entire class

If you’re students, creating and gifting a surprise movie from the whole class to the birthday star is a touching idea.

The lyrics of the song used as background music are written on sketchbooks and filmed in a relay format.

Using smartphone apps, it’s easy to edit separately taken photos into a slideshow.

paper shower

This video explains how to make a paper confetti shower using everyday materials.

You can create it with a toilet paper roll core, a balloon, and confetti.

Wrap it with patterned paper to make it even cuter! A one-of-a-kind paper confetti shower is perfect for a special-day surprise.
